About St Paul Elementary School
St Paul Elementary School is a private elementary school in Los Angeles, CA. St Paul Elementary School serves approximately 122 students, and covers grades Kindergarten-8th, and has a 11.2:1 student-teacher ratio. St Paul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.6 out of 10 and ranks #676 of 1,787 private schools in CA.

What Parents Should Know
At 122 students, St Paul Elementary School is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.
St Paul Elementary School is private, so it runs independently of the local district and sets its own curriculum. That freedom cuts both ways depending on what you want for your child. If you're considering it, start with the practical questions: tuition, financial aid, and how admissions work.

Is St Paul Elementary School a private school?
Yes, St Paul Elementary School is a private coeducational school with a Roman Catholic affiliation. Private schools are not required to participate in state standardized testing, so academic performance data may be limited compared to public schools.
Is St Paul Elementary School a religious school?
St Paul Elementary School has a Roman Catholic religious affiliation.
